About Us
Areas of Focus: 
Mission: 

Collaborate, co-deliver solutions, accelerate adoption of digital capabilities, and upskill workforces to make measurable increases in U.S. manufacturing’s competitiveness.

Programs: 

MxD has invested more than $150 million in more than 85 projects in areas including future factory, digital twin, resilient supply chains, operational technology, cybersecurity, and workforce development.  MxD hosts workshops, demonstrates digital technologies in its state of the art Future Factory, performs digital and cybersecurity assessments, provides tools educating the workforce for the future.

About Us
Mission: 

The Alzheimer's Association works on a global, national and local level to provide care and support for those affected by Alzheimer's and other dementias.

Programs: 

The Alzheimer’s Association is the leading voluntary health organization in Alzheimer’s care, support and research. Our mission is to lead the way to end Alzheimer's and all other dementia- by accelerating global research, driving risk reduction and early detection, and maximizing quality care and support.
